#2bd3c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2bd3c2 is composed of 16.9% red, 82.7%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.1%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 173.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.1% and a lightness of 49.8%. #2bd3c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#56ffff with #00a785.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#2bd3c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2bd3c2 has RGB values of R:43, G:211,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 2872258.
